Cleft palate repair is usually done when the child is older (between 9 months and 1 year old), to allow the palate to change as the baby grows. WebWhat is cleft lip and cleft palate, and how often do cleft conditions occur? A cleft condition is a gap in the mouth that didn't close during the early stages of pregnancy, and this happens more often than you may realize. Figure 2 is a visual symbolic classification of cleft lip and palate cases. For documentation and classification purposes, clinical findings in cleft lip alveolus and palate patients are transferred into a “Y-scheme”.
